Java Broker - AMQP0-9 Tactical Producer Flow Control
Page added by Rob Godfrey
Problem Statement
The Java Broker currently performs no throttling of producing clients. In combination with the way that the Java Broker holds every transient m
Java Broker - AMQP0-9 Tactical Producer Flow Control
Page edited by Rob Godfrey
Problem Statement
The Java Broker currently performs no throttling of producing clients. In combination with the way that the Java Broker holds every t
New Page
Page added by Martin Ritchie
Purpose
This page is intended to outline the known use cases for running multiple Java Brokers, addressing logged issues and limitations of the current implementation (as of V0.5). It is not about cluste
New Page
Page edited by Martin Ritchie
Purpose
This page is intended to outline the known use cases for running multiple Java Brokers, addressing logged issues and limitations of the current implementation (as of V0.5). It is not ab
New Page
Page edited by Martin Ritchie
Purpose
This page is intended to outline the known use cases for running multiple Java Brokers, addressing logged issues and limitations of the current implementation (as of V0.5). It is not ab
New Page
Page edited by Martin Ritchie
Purpose
This page is intended to outline the known use cases for running multiple Java Brokers, addressing logged issues and limitations of the current implementation (as of V0.5). It is not ab
New Page
Page edited by Martin Ritchie
Purpose
This page is intended to outline the known use cases for running multiple Java Brokers, addressing logged issues and limitations of the current implementation (as of V0.5). It is not ab
New Page
Page edited by Martin Ritchie
Purpose
This page is intended to outline the known use cases for running multiple Java Brokers, addressing logged issues and limitations of the current implementation (as of V0.5). It is not ab
New Page
Page edited by Martin Ritchie
Purpose
This page is intended to outline the known use cases for running multiple Java Brokers, addressing logged issues and limitations of the current implementation (as of V0.5). It is not ab
Multiple Java Brokers - Use Cases
Page edited by Martin Ritchie
Purpose
This page is intended to outline the known use cases for running multiple Java Brokers, addressing logged issues and limitations of the current implementation (
Qpid Management Console User Guide
File attached by Robbie Gemmell
Qpid_JMX_MC_User_Guide.pdf
(977 kB application/pdf)
Qpid_JMX_MC_User_Guide.doc
(598 kB application/msword)
Create User Tab
File removed by Robbie Gemmell
CreateUserTab.bmp (548 kB image/bmp)
Change Notification Preferences
View Attachments
--
Create User Tab
Page removed by Robbie Gemmell
Screenshot
Unable to render embedded object: File (CreateUserTab.bmp) not found.
Usage
This interface allows for the creation of a new user.
Required Fields
Username
Password
Optional Fie
Reload Data Tab
File removed by Robbie Gemmell
ReloadDataTab.bmp (398 kB image/bmp)
Change Notification Preferences
View Attachments
--
Reload Data Tab
Page removed by Robbie Gemmell
Screenshot
Unable to render embedded object: File (ReloadDataTab.bmp) not found.
Usage
The 'Reload Data' tab allows the password files to be re-read from disk.
Currently the password and jmxre
Qpid Management Console User Guide
Page edited by Robbie Gemmell
Please refer to our User Guide (DOC) (PDF) for an overview of the features provided by the console.
Change Notification Preferences
UserManagement Tab
Page removed by Robbie Gemmell
-
Apache Qpid - AMQP Messaging Implementation
Project: http://qpid.apache.org
Use/Interact: mailto:commits
Add New Users
Page edited by Robbie Gemmell
The Qpid Java Broker has a single reference source (PrincipalDatabase) that defines all the users in the system.
To add a new user to the broker the password file must be updated. The deta
Qpid JMX Management Console
Page edited by Robbie Gemmell
Qpid JMX Management Console
Overview
The Qpid JMX Management Console is a standalone Eclipse RCP application that communicates with the broker using JMX.
Configuring Manag
Qpid JMX Management Console User Guide
Page edited by Robbie Gemmell
Please refer to our User Guide (DOC) (PDF) for an overview of the features provided by the console.
Change Notification Preferences
Qpid Java FAQ
Page edited by Robbie Gemmell
Purpose
Here are a list of commonly asked questions and answers. Click on the the bolded questions for the answer to unfold. If you have any questions which are not on this list, please em
Configuring Qpid JMXManagement Console
Page edited by Robbie Gemmell
Configuring Qpid JMX Management Console
Qpid has a JMX management interface that exposes a number of components of the running broker.
You can find out more about
Configuring Qpid JMX Management Console
Page edited by Robbie Gemmell
Configuring Qpid JMX Management Console
Qpid has a JMX management interface that exposes a number of components of the running broker.
You can find out more abou
Qpid JMX Management Console
File removed by Robbie Gemmell
Qpid_Management_Console.doc (424 kB application/msword)
-
screen-shots of management console (Eclipse RCP)
C
Qpid JMX Management Console FAQ
Page edited by Robbie Gemmell
Errors
How do I connect the management console to my broker using security ?
The Management Console Security page will give you the instructions that you should use
Qpid JMX Management Console User Guide
File attached by Robbie Gemmell
Qpid_JMX_MC_User_Guide.pdf
(974 kB application/pdf)
Qpid_JMX_MC_User_Guide.doc
(599 kB application/msword)
Starting a cluster
Page edited by Alan Conway
Running a Qpidd cluster
There are several pre-requisites to running a qpidd cluster:
Install and configure openais/corosync
Qpid clustering uses a multicast protocol provided by the co
Qpid Management Console Testing
File attached by Robbie Gemmell
Qpid_JMX_MC_Testing_Guide.pdf
(1.01 MB application/pdf)
Qpid_JMX_MC_Testing_Guide.doc
(616 kB application/msword)
Qpid Management Console Testing
Page edited by Robbie Gemmell
Please refer to our Testing Guide (DOC) (PDF) for an overview of the testing procedures for the console.
Change Notification Preferences
Qpid Management Console Testing
Page edited by Robbie Gemmell
Reverted from v. 3
Reverted from v. 3
Background
Test Platforms
Introduction
Installation and Testing
General Test and Setup Inf
Qpid JMX Management Console Testing Guide
Page added by Robbie Gemmell
The guide can be found below in wiki form, or downloaded as a file: (DOC) (PDF)
Introduction
General Test Configuration & Startup
Server configuration
Console confi
Qpid Management Console Testing (Old UI)
File removed by Robbie Gemmell
Qpid_JMX_MC_Testing_Guide.pdf (1.01 MB application/pdf)
Change Notification Preferences
View Attachments
Qpid Management Console Testing (Old UI)
File removed by Robbie Gemmell
Qpid_JMX_MC_Testing_Guide.doc (616 kB application/msword)
Change Notification Preferences
View Attachmen
Developer Pages
Page edited by Robbie Gemmell
Developer Pages
Process Notes
Release Process
Testing
Qpid JMX Management Console Testing Guide
Interop Testing Specification - Common test cases to ensure all clients and brokers
Qpid JMX Management Console Testing Guide
File attached by Robbie Gemmell
jmx_mc_testing_files.zip
(7 kB application/zip)
Change Notification Preferences
View Attachment
Qpid Management Console Testing (Old UI)
Page moved by Robbie Gemmell
From:
Apache Qpid
> Developer Pages
To:
Apache Qpid
> Qpid JMX
Qpid Management Console Testing (Old UI)
Page edited by Robbie Gemmell
Background
Test Platforms
Introduction
Installation and Testing
General Test and Setup Information
Administration
Virtual Host Manag
Qpid JMX Management Console User Guide
Page edited by Robbie Gemmell
Qpid JMX Management Console
User Guide
Contents
Introduction
Startup & Configuration
Startup
SSL configuration
JMXMP configuration
Managing Server Conn
Qpid JMX Management Console User Guide
File attached by Robbie Gemmell
Qpid_JMX_MC_User_Guide.pdf
(976 kB application/pdf)
Qpid_JMX_MC_User_Guide.doc
(603 kB application/msword)
Qpid JMX Management Console User Guide
Page edited by Robbie Gemmell
The guide can be found below in wiki form, or downloaded as a file: (DOC) (PDF)
Introduction
Startup & Configuration
Startup
SSL configuration
JMXMP config
QMan - Qpid Management bridge
Page edited by Andrea Gazzarini
QMan : Qpid Management Bridge
QMan is a management bridge for Qpid. It allows external clients to manage and monitor one or more Qpid brokers.
Please note: All WS-DM rel
Qpid Java Build How To
Page edited by Robbie Gemmell
Build Instructions - General
Check out the source
Firstly, check the source for Qpid out of our subversion repository:
https://svn.apache.org/repos/asf/qpid/trunk
Prerequisites
Prefetch
Page edited by Aidan Skinner
AMQP supports prefetch which specifies how many messages the client wishes to cache for delivery. The method Session.setDefaultPrefetch(int) allows a default value to be configured at the session
Prefetch
Page added by Aidan Skinner
AMQP supports prefetch which specifies how many messages the client wishes to cache for delivery. The method Session.setDefaultPrefetch(int) allows a default value to be configured at the session level and
Qpid Design - Message Acknowledgement
Page edited by Aidan Skinner
Message Acknowledgements and Delivery Modes
When implementing the JMS client it became apparent that the JMS specification offered a considerable degree of latitude
Qpid Design - Application Registry
Page removed by Aidan Skinner
The Application Registry is a more sophisticated version of the widely used singleton pattern. It allows the registration of services with a central component that manages the lif
Qpid Design - Queue Implementation
Page added by Aidan Skinner
Strict Ordering
Enqueing
Strict Ordering
The fundamental principal of the Queuing model is that the queue provides a strict order on the messages being enqueued. Fur
Qpid Design - Queue Implementation
File attached by Aidan Skinner
broker-queue-subscription.png
(7 kB image/png)
Change Notification Preferences
View Attachments
Qpid Design - Queue Implementation
Page edited by Aidan Skinner
Strict Ordering
Enqueing
Strict Ordering
The fundamental principal of the Queuing model is that the queue provides a strict order on the messages being enqu
Qpid Design - Message Delivery
Page added by Aidan Skinner
Asynchronous Delivery
Subscriptions
Removal
Flow Control
Acknowledgement
Reject and Release
Asynchronous Delivery
If there are no subscriptions that can c
Qpid Design - Queue Implementation
File attached by Aidan Skinner
broker-priority-queue-subscription.png
(14 kB image/png)
Change Notification Preferences
View Attachmen
Qpid Design - Queue Implementation
Page edited by Aidan Skinner
Strict Ordering
Enqueing
Priority Queues
Strict Ordering
The fundamental principal of the Queuing model is that the queue provides a strict order on the
Qpid Design - Configuration
Page edited by Aidan Skinner
Configuration Methods
QPID supports two methods of configuration:
command line switches (e.g. passing a -p flag on startup to specify the port)
configuration file
It is
Qpid Design - Management
Page edited by Robbie Gemmell
The broker makes several general JMX MBeans available for functionality such as User Management and Logging Management, as well as MBeans to allow management of each individual C
Qpid Design - Configuration
Page edited by Robbie Gemmell
Configuration Methods
QPID supports two methods of configuration:
command line switches (e.g. passing a -p flag on startup to specify the port)
configuration file
It is
Management Console Security
Page edited by Robbie Gemmell
SSL encrypted RMI (0.5 and above)
Current versions of the broker make use of SSL encryption to secure their RMI based JMX ConnectorServer for security purposes. This ships en
Qpid JMX Management Console FAQ
Page edited by Robbie Gemmell
Errors
How do I connect the management console to my broker using security ?
The Management Console Security page will give you the instructions that you should use
Qpid Design - Framing
File attached by Aidan Skinner
frame-decoding.png
(24 kB image/png)
Change Notification Preferences
View Attachments
--
Qpid Design - Framing
Page edited by Aidan Skinner
Frame Classes
The framing definition in the protocol specification maps quite nicely to an object-oriented representation. The class diagram is shown below:
The AMQDataBlock at t
Java Unit Tests with InVM Broker
Page moved by Rob Godfrey
From:
Apache Qpid
> Qpid Java Documentation
To:
Apache Qpid
> Port server
Qpid Java Client refactoring
Page moved by Martin Ritchie
From:
Apache Qpid
> Qpid Java Documentation
To:
Apache Qpid
> Port server
Java Architecture Overview
Page moved by Martin Ritchie
From:
Apache Qpid
> Qpid Developer Documentation
To:
Apache Qpid
> Port serv
Java Coding Standards
Page moved by Robert Greig
From:
Apache Qpid
> Qpid Java Documentation
To:
Apache Qpid
> Port server to new in
Qpid Developer Documentation
Page moved by Robert Greig
From:
Apache Qpid
> Qpid Java Documentation
To:
Apache Qpid
> Developer Page
Java Broker Design - High Level Overview of Refactoring
Page moved by Martin Ritchie
From:
Apache Qpid
> Qpid Developer Documentation
To:
Apache
Java Broker Configuration Design
Page moved by Aidan Skinner
From:
Apache Qpid
> Qpid Developer Documentation
To:
Apache Qpid
> Port
Java Broker Design - Flow to Disk
Page moved by Martin Ritchie
From:
Apache Qpid
> Qpid Developer Documentation
To:
Apache Qpid
> Ja
Java Broker Refactor (QPID-950)
Page moved by Rob Godfrey
From:
Apache Qpid
> Qpid Developer Documentation
To:
Apache Qpid
> Status
Java Broker Design - MessageStore
Page moved by Martin Ritchie
From:
Apache Qpid
> Qpid Developer Documentation
To:
Apache Qpid
> Ja
Prefetch
Page moved by Aidan Skinner
From:
Apache Qpid
> Qpid Developer Documentation
To:
Apache Qpid
> Message API Design
Java Broker Design - Operational Logging
Page moved by Martin Ritchie
From:
Apache Qpid
> Qpid Developer Documentation
To:
Apache Qpid
Message API Design
Page moved by Rajith Attapattu
From:
Apache Qpid
> Qpid Developer Documentation
To:
Apache Qpid
> Java Broker Ref
Qpid Design - Access Control Lists
Page moved by Martin Ritchie
From:
Apache Qpid
> Qpid Developer Documentation
To:
Apache Qpid
> P
Qpid Design - Authentication
Page moved by Martin Ritchie
From:
Apache Qpid
> Qpid Developer Documentation
To:
Apache Qpid
> Qpid De
Qpid Design - Queue Implementation
Page moved by Aidan Skinner
From:
Apache Qpid
> Qpid Developer Documentation
To:
Apache Qpid
> Qp
Qpid Design - Message Delivery
Page moved by Aidan Skinner
From:
Apache Qpid
> Qpid Developer Documentation
To:
Apache Qpid
> Qpid D
Qpid Design - Threading
Page moved by Robert Greig
From:
Apache Qpid
> Qpid Developer Documentation
To:
Apache Qpid
> Qpid Design -
Qpid Design - Management
Page moved by Robbie Gemmell
From:
Apache Qpid
> Qpid Developer Documentation
To:
Apache Qpid
> Qpid Design
Restructuring Java Broker and Client Design
Page moved by Rajith Attapattu
From:
Apache Qpid
> Qpid Developer Documentation
To:
Apache Qpid
Qpid Design - Framing
Page moved by Aidan Skinner
From:
Apache Qpid
> Qpid Developer Documentation
To:
Apache Qpid
> QpidBrokerComma
Qpid Design - Configuration
Page moved by Robbie Gemmell
From:
Apache Qpid
> Qpid Developer Documentation
To:
Apache Qpid
> Qpid Des
Qpid Design - Message Acknowledgement
Page moved by Aidan Skinner
From:
Apache Qpid
> Qpid Developer Documentation
To:
Apache Qpid
>
Testing Design - Java Broker CPU GC Monitoring
Page moved by Martin Ritchie
From:
Apache Qpid
> Qpid Developer Documentation
To:
Apache Qpid
The AMQP Distributed Transaction Classes
Page moved by Carl Trieloff
From:
Apache Qpid
> Qpid Developer Documentation
To:
Apache Qpid
Java Broker Configuration Design
Page moved by Aidan Skinner
From:
Apache Qpid
> Port server to new interface tests
To:
Apache Qpid
Current Architecture
Page moved by Aidan Skinner
From:
Apache Qpid
> Network IO Interface
To:
Apache Qpid
> Developer Pages
MessageProducer.send() behaviour
Page moved by Aidan Skinner
From:
Apache Qpid
> Network IO Interface
To:
Apache Qpid
> Developer Pa
Java Architecture Overview
Page moved by Martin Ritchie
From:
Apache Qpid
> Port server to new interface tests
To:
Apache Qpid
> Dev
Qpid Java Client refactoring
Page moved by Martin Ritchie
From:
Apache Qpid
> Port server to new interface tests
To:
Apache Qpid
> D
Java Unit Tests with InVM Broker
Page moved by Rob Godfrey
From:
Apache Qpid
> Port server to new interface tests
To:
Apache Qpid
>
Java Broker Design - High Level Overview of Refactoring
Page moved by Martin Ritchie
From:
Apache Qpid
> FtD Code Review Notes
To:
Apache Qpid
Java Broker Design - MessageStore
Page moved by Martin Ritchie
From:
Apache Qpid
> Java Broker Design - Message Representation
To:
Apache Qpid
Java Coding Standards
Page moved by Robert Greig
From:
Apache Qpid
> Port server to new interface
To:
Apache Qpid
> Developer Pages
Java Broker Design - High Level Overview of Refactoring
Page moved by Martin Ritchie
From:
Apache Qpid
> Port server to new interface
To:
Apache
Java Broker Design - Message Representation
Page moved by Martin Ritchie
From:
Apache Qpid
> Java Broker Design - High Level Overview of Refactoring
To:
Java Broker Refactor (QPID-950)
Page moved by Rob Godfrey
From:
Apache Qpid
> Status Update Design
To:
Apache Qpid
> Operational Log
Java Broker Refactor (QPID-950)
Page moved by Rob Godfrey
From:
Apache Qpid
> Operational Logging - Status Update - Test Plan
To:
Apache Qpid
Testing Design - Java Broker CPU GC Monitoring
Page moved by Martin Ritchie
From:
Apache Qpid
> Restructuring Java Broker and Client Design
To:
Qpid Design - Queue Implementation
Page moved by Aidan Skinner
From:
Apache Qpid
> Qpid Design - Message Delivery
To:
Apache Qpid
>
The AMQP Distributed Transaction Classes
Page moved by Carl Trieloff
From:
Apache Qpid
> Testing Design - Java Broker CPU GC Monitoring
To:
Apac
701 - 800 of 2259 matches
Mail list logo